网站运维

    Nginx 参考配置

    1. listen 80;
    2. location / {
    3. rewrite ^/(.*)$ https://www.modstart.com/$1 permanent;
    4. }
    5. }

    通过CDN可以将动态请求、静态资源分离,加速网站的访问。我们推荐如下的CDN加速方式

    CDN静态资源更新问题

    系统已经默认安装了 predis/predis 扩展,只需要以下简单配置即可完成缓存驱动切换。

    配置完成后清除系统缓存

    使用 CDN 优化静态资源加载速度,如七牛、网易、百度、阿里云等,具体方法可网上自行查找。

    2. 优化后端服务响应速度

    第一步,安装并开启 OPCache ,可以让网站加载速度提升。

    1. [opcache]
    2. opcache.enable=1
    3. ; 可用内存, 酌情而定, 单位为:Mb
    4. opcache.memory_consumption=528
    5. ; Zend Optimizer + 暂存池中字符串的占内存总量.(单位:MB)
    6. opcache.max_accelerated_files=10000
    7. ; Opcache 会在一定时间内去检查文件的修改时间, 这里设置检查的时间周期, 默认为 2, 定位为秒
    8. ; 生产环境,代码不变可以关闭0
    9. opcache.revalidate_freq=1

    第二步,使用Laravel优化命令优化系统加载流程

    1. ## 清除缓存路由
    2. php artisan route:clear
    3. ## 清除缓存配置
    4. php artisan config:clear